Performance of Cabled Optical Fiber
Cable bending radius: 10 x cable diameter (static)
20 x cable diameter (dynamic)
The performance of cabled optical fiber (ITU-T Rec. G.652D)
Item | Specification |
Fiber type | Single mode |
Fiber material | Doped silica |
Attenuation coefficient @ 1310 nm @ 1383 nm @ 1550 nm @ 1625 nm |
≤ 0.36 dB/km ≤ 0.32 dB/km ≤ 0.22 dB/km ≤ 0.30 dB/km |
Point discontinuity | ≤ 0.05 dB |
Cable cut-off wavelength | ≤ 1260 nm |
Zero-dispersion wavelength | 1300 ~ 1324 nm |
Zero-dispersion slope | ≤ 0.093 ps/(nm².km) |
Chromatic dispersion @ 1288 ~ 1339 nm @ 1271 ~ 1360 nm @ 1550 nm @ 1625 nm |
≤3.5 ps/(nm. km) ≤5.3 ps/(nm. km) ≤18 ps/(nm. km) ≤22 ps/(nm. km) |
PMDQ (Quadrature average*) | ≤0.2 ps/km½ |
Mode field diameter @ 1310 nm | (8.6~9.5)±0.6 um |
Core / Clad concentricity error | ≤ 0.6 um |
Cladding diameter | 125.0 ± 1 um |
Cladding non-circularity | ≤1.0% |
Primary coating diameter | 245 ± 10 um |
Proof test level | 100 kpsi (=0.69 Gpa), 1% |
Temperature dependence 0oC~ +70oC @ 1310 & 1550nm |
≤0.1 dB/km |
Main mechanical & environmental performance test
S/N | Item | Test Method | Acceptance Condition |
1 | Tensile Strength IEC 794-1-E1 |
- Load: 6,000N 50 m |
- Loss change £ 0.1 dB @1550 nm - No fiber break and no sheath damage. |
2 | Crush Test IEC 794-1-E3 |
- Load: 1,000 N/100 mm - Load time: ≥1min. |
- Loss change £ 0.1 dB @1550 nm - No fiber break and no sheath damage. |
3 | Impact Resistance IEC 794-1-E4 |
- Points of impact: 5 12.5mm |
- Loss change £ 0.1 dB @1550 nm - No fiber break and no sheath damage. |
4 | Repeated Bending IEC 794-1-E6 |
- Bending radius: 20 x cable diameter |
- Loss change £ 0.1 dB @1550 nm - No fiber break and no sheath damage. |
5 | Torsion IEC 794-1-E7 |
- Length: 1 m - Load: 150 N - Twist rate: 1 min/cycle - Twist angle: ±180° - No. of cycle: 10 |
- Loss change £ 0.1 dB @1550 nm - No fiber break and no sheath damage. |
6 |
Water Penetration Test |
- Height of water: 1 m - Sample length: 3 m - Test time: 24 hours |
- No water shall have leaked from the opposite end of cable. |
7 |
Temperature Cycling Test |
- Temperature step: +20ºC→-40ºC→+60ºC→+20ºC - Time per each step: 24 hrs - Number of cycle: 2 |
- Loss change £ 0.05 dB/km@1550 nm - No fiber break and no sheath damage. |
8 | Compound Flow IEC 794-1-E14 |
- Sample length: 30 cm - Temp: 70°C ± 2°C - Time: 24 hours |
- No compound flow |
